**SUMMARY**

Under close supervision, the Parts Distribution Specialist receives incoming parts and materials, checks for incoming order accuracy and quality, and stores the items in the appropriate locations. Retrieves parts and materials based upon customer order input and ensures that ordered items are packaged and shipped to the appropriate location. Ensure that all documentation is completed and processed accurately.
